This Week In Science: Ultra-cool Stars

And by ultra-cool stars I don’t mean the famous person-kind. I mean little itty-bitty stars. Stars so small that if they were any smaller, they wouldn’t be stars, they’d occupy a vague area between brown-dwarf object and super-jovian gas giant. But TRAPPIST-1 is just barely above the necessary mass to fuse hydrogen and that makes it a full-fledged star, albeit a very dim, very red one.
